WebApr 5, 2024 · An edited book is where each chapter is by different author (s), and an editor (s) pulls them together and perhaps writes an introduction. You must cite/reference the individual chapter you used, rather than the book as a whole (it is possible you would cite and reference a number of chapters separately that are from the same edited book). …

When citing the volume as a whole, the editor’s name and initials should be included in place of the author’s: Editor’s Surname, Initial (s). (Ed.) (Year). Title: Subtitle. Publisher. Capitalize the first letter of the first word of the title. If there is a colon (:) or question mark in the title, also capitalize the first letter of the first word after the colon or question mark.
